Tennessee Statutes

§ 31-7-117 — Severability clause

Tennessee·Title 31
If any provision of this chapter or its application to any person or circumstance is held invalid, the invalidity does not affect other provisions or applications of this chapter which can be given effect without the invalid provision or application, and to that end the provisions of this chapter are declared to be severable.

Legislative History

Added by 2019 Tenn. Acts, ch. 340,s 2, eff. 5/10/2019.
